COMMERCE BUSINESS DAILY ISSUE OF AUGUST 8,1997 PSA#1905Commander, Naval Air Systems Command (Code 2.3), Patuxent Naval Air
Station, Bldg 2272, Lexington Park, MD 20670 14 -- REPAIR OF REPAIRABLES BASIC ORDERING AGREEMENT EXTENSION POC
Linda Mobley, Contract Specialist, 301-757-5931 17. The Naval Air
Systems Command (NAVAIR) intends to negotiate a Basic Ordering
Agreement (BOA) extension for 01 October 1997 to 30 September 1998 with
The Boeing Company for repair of repairable items for the Harpoon
Missile, the Stand-off Land Attack Missile (SLAM) and the Stand-off
Land Attack Missile Extended Response (SLAM ER) weapon systems. This
includes the repair and return-to-ready-condition of: the
Harpoon/SLAM/SLAM ER missiles; Harpoon/SLAM/SLAM ER missile sections;
weapon replaceable assemblies; shop replaceable assemblies, capsules,
components, and subassemblies; Harpoon/SLAM weapon stations;
Harpoon/SLAM support equipment; test equipment and other related
supplies, services, and associated data. Also included is the
procurement/incorporation of Technical Directives (TDs) into
Harpoon/SLAM/SLAM ER missile and missile related equipment and the
incidental repair of Harpoon/SLAM/SLAM ER missile and missile related
equipment that may be required during incorporation of TDs; integrated
logistics support services; spare and repair parts; technical
training; technical manuals; publications and documentation; support
equipment; depot storage and supply operations; and engineering
technical services for the Harpoon/SLAM/SLAM ER weapon system for both
U.S. Navy and Foreign Military Sales (FMS) Customers. The Boeing
Company, P.O. Box 516, St. Louis, MO 63166-0516 is the sole developer,
designer, and manufacturer of the Harpoon/SLAM/SLAM ER missile systems
and the only known firm possessing the necessary knowledge, data,
equipment, facilities, and experience to perform the effort in the
required timeframe. (0218) Loren Data Corp. http://www.ld.com (SYN# 0264 19970808\14-0002.SOL)
